
Turkey, One Belt One Road Revitalization Project of forming the fastest rail route between China and Europe continues to negotiate targeted for the middle corridor.
TCDD General Manager Ali İhsan Uygun shared information about the latest status of the project in Xi'an, China, where he was to sign important agreements.
We are aiming to reach 1000 trains and more
Uygun said in an interview with TRT News that; Dik We had very important meetings with both the provincial managers and the Logistics Park managers in Xi'an, China. In particular, we made agreements for the continuation of the freight train that we sent off on November 6, 2019. We will continue these transportations in 300 with approximately 2020 trains, and we aim to reach 3 trains in 4 to 1000 years. ”
The Middle Aisle offers the shortest and most economical route to Europe via the Silk Road. The project is planned with Turkey to export more goods to the countries in the routes,.
In the interview, Uygun also gave the good news of the export train that will set out in China in the near future and which includes products belonging to different sectors.
